It is therefore possible to )btain any degree or variation of both !ffects. Wild! :ender Hwang ;ive yourself a complete new experience n sound with the Fender Vibratone. The 'ibratone incorporates the famed Leslie 'ibrato Speaker System which, when ised in conjunction with a standard amdifier, gives all instruments, including uitar and organ, a tonal versatility from athedral elegance to funky blues delending on your control settings. wo distinctly different tremolo sounds re available as the unit has two speeds ontrolled by a foot switch. A second witch enables the player to change rom the regular guitar amplifier's speaker to the Vibratone. A unique crossover system allows both low and very high frequencies to always emanate from the regular amp speaker(s) when the signal is switched to Vibratone. This maintains a constant clean mid-range tremolo tone in the Vibratone Unit. Construction is of 3/4" wood with lockjoint corners to withstand hard professional use. It is covered in black vinyl "Tolex" and has silver-blue grill cloth to match Fender Amplifier styling. Fender Echo-Revere Unit Utilizing a unique disc-type delay, the Echo-Reverb Unit delivers echo, reverberation and vibrato. This transistorized electrostatic memory system stores audio signals for a moment; then reproduces and repeats them. Individual echoes or a reverberant effect from a blend of rapidly repeating echoes may be obtained. Light vibrato is incorporated in the circuit and is present at any setting. The cabinet is built to take the hardest professional use and styled to match Fender Amplifiers. Front controls include: echo volume (including power on-off), reverberation, echo delay (settings of long-short-combined), remote foot switch jack, two instrument input jacks, amplifier output jack and pilot light.
